Assessing the performance of the Cell Painting assay across different imaging systems

2023-02-15

Abstract excerpt

Quantitative microscopy is a powerful method for performing phenotypic screens from which image-based profiling can extract a wealth of information, termed profiles. These profiles can be used to elucidate the changes in cellular phenotypes across cell populations from different patient samples or following genetic or chemical perturbations.
